Orapa Bowling Club tournament champions

29 May 2022

Orapa Bowling Club was on Saturday declared champions of the national tournament. Team Orapa emerged the winners followed by Jwaneng team whilst Francistown Bowling Club took position three at the just ended tournament in Orapa. 

Team Orapa won the singles and fours in both women and men’s games.  It also won the pairs and triples in the women category whilst Jwaneng and Francistown won the pairs and triples in the men’s games respectively.

In the women singles game, Tshenolo Moshokgo of team Orapa humiliated Boikhutso Mooketsi of Jwaneng with an 8-0 score line.

In the men’s singles, Fred Kelatwang of Orapa fought hard to win 3-2 against Binesh Desai of Francistown. The pairs in the women category were won by Tshenolo Moshokgo and Mpho Khubi of Orapa while in the men’s section it was won by Charles Diteko and Joseph Nthobalang of Jwaneng through a 19-13 score against Edwin Nyoka and Kaizer Geche of Orapa.

The men’s triples were won by Sonny Mbisana, Bala Balendra and Gerrit Pretorious of Francistown team in a round robin through a slim margin of 14-13.

The ladies triples were won by Deliwe Kitsiso, Judith Baleseng and Chandapiwa Mothowamodimo of Team Orapa in a round robin.

The men’s fours game was won by Kitso Robert, Edwin Nyoka, Boago Galeboe and Kabelo Motshabi of Orapa while the ladies fours were won by Moshokgo, Doreen Moleleki, Gape Rapula and Mpho Khubi also from the Orapa team.

The competition secretary, George Kieni said Moshokgo and Kelatwang, who emerged players of the tournament, would represent the country in the Singles Champions of Champions.
